
About This Property
Three Meeting Place comprises 43 units in Exeter, NH, with 38 units designated as low-income housing that serve families. The property offers a mix of studio, one-bedroom, and two-bedroom apartments and has been in service since 2018. This non-profit owned community is funded through CDBG and utilizes 9% LIHTC credits.

Fair Market Rent - Rockingham County, NH
FMR represents the estimated amount needed to cover rent and utilities for a moderately-priced unit in this area.
| Bedrooms | FMR |
|---|---|
| Studio/Efficiency | $1,299 |
| 1 Bedroom | $1,483 |
| 2 Bedroom | $1,917 |
| 3 Bedroom | $2,329 |
| 4 Bedroom | $2,553 |

| Household | Extremely Low (30%) | Very Low (50%) | Low (80%) |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1 Person | $21,600 | $36,050 | $55,950 |
| 2 Persons | $24,700 | $41,200 | $63,950 |
| 3 Persons | $27,800 | $46,350 | $71,950 |
| 4 Persons | $30,850 | $51,450 | $79,900 |
| 5 Persons | $33,350 | $55,600 | $86,300 |
| 6 Persons | $35,800 | $59,700 | $92,700 |
| 7 Persons | $40,120 | $63,800 | $99,100 |
| 8 Persons | $44,660 | $67,950 | $105,500 |
